Two Congress Workers Die During Protests in UP and Assam

Rahul Gandhi accuses BJP-led state governments of excessive police force, demands justice for the deceased families.

  • Congress workers Prabhat Pandey in Uttar Pradesh and Mridul Islam in Assam died during protests organized by the party on December 18, 2024.
  • Rahul Gandhi condemned the deaths, attributing them to excessive police force, and called for justice for the families of the deceased.
  • In Assam, Congress claimed Mridul Islam died from suffocation caused by tear gas deployed during the protest, though police denied firing tear gas shells and await a post-mortem report.
  • In Uttar Pradesh, Prabhat Pandey was declared dead upon arrival at a hospital, with police stating no visible injuries and awaiting post-mortem results for confirmation.
  • The protests were part of a nationwide Congress campaign addressing issues such as Manipur violence, bribery allegations against the Adani Group, and other grievances.
